While it may work, it risks triggering a TLB conflict abort. The correct sequence normally is: pmd_clear(); flush_tlb_kernel_range(); __pmd_populate(); However, do we have any guarantees that the kernel doesn't access the pmd range being unmapped temporarily? The page table itself might live in one of these sections, so set_pmd() etc. can get a translation fault. -- Catalin
